1995 sea rayder

I have a 1995 sea ray sea rayder....the boat ran fine tell it got swamped
in a micro burst in Fl....now the engine will not start..( got all the water out of it)....the engine is hard to turn by hand...the engine is a sport jet 120

junk it or ????

How long was it underwater? If less then a day and this event was less then a half a week ago, you might be able to save it. If it was longer, it needs to be rebuilt. or changed out.

You should assume there's rust in places you don't want it, if it's hard to turn without the plugs in it. Most engines that have been submerged can be saved easily, if you get to them right away, drain them and start them up, to boil off any moisture or "pickle" them until you can get to it. If they sit for a while, they rust in a heartbeat and need to be broken down, cleaned, machined and reassembled.
